1891 Edenbridge Census
Reference RG12/675: District: Sevenoaks; Sub-District: Penshurst; Enumerator: W. E. Norman
Boundary Bounded on the North by the South Eastern Railway, on the East by a line drawn from the South Eastern Railway Bridge on the East side of the Houses in Edenbridge Town to Hever Lane, on the South by a line drawn from Hever Lane to the Boundary of Lingfield Parish and on the West by Lingfield and Limspfield Parishes
Contents All the Town of Eden Bridge on both side to Hever Lane including all that part that lies west of the Town between the River and the South Eastern Railway comprising Pound Lane, Poplars, Starysore, Keynes, Brook House, Crouch House Green, Great and Little Browns, New House Farm, Sunnyside, Coal Wharf Cottages and Cottages at Spratts Cross, Smithfield, Brick Field, The Station and cottages of the London, Brighton and South Coast Railway
The Whole in the Parliamentary Division of Tonbridge

Sheet    Place    Census entry

21Water MillMartha Stanford, F, Head, widowed, age 56, born Edenbridge, Kent
    Edith Stanford, F, Daughter, single, age 26, born Edenbridge, Kent
    Fred Stanford, M, Son, single, age 25,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: miller
    Herbert H Stanford, M, Son, single, age 22,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: clerk
    Auston Stanford, M, Son, single, age 19,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: miller

21Mill CottageJane Cheal, F, Head, widowed, age 85, born Westerham, Kent

21Mill CottageEliza Smeed, F, Head, widowed, age 64,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: chapel keeper

21Mill CottageJames Boorer, M, Head, married, age 39, born Dormansland, Surrey; occupation: carman
    Thomasine Boorer, F, Wife, married, age 42, born Week St Mary, Cornwall
    Gertrude M Boorer, F, Daughter, age 12, born Dormansland, Surrey; occupation: scholar
    Thomasine E Boorer, F, Daughter, age 11,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: scholar
    Bessie Boorer, F, Daughter, age 8,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: scholar
    Samuel Ja Boorer, M, Son, age 6, born Edenbridge, Kent
    George Wood, M, Visitor, married, age 70, born East Grinstead, Sussex; occupation Wood Cleaver
    Edwin Blackman, M, Boarder, single, age 19, born Mayfield, Sussex, occupation: tanner

21Mill CottageAbraham Smith, M, Head, married, age 56, born Lingfield, Surrey; occupation: farm labourer
    Charlotte Smith, F, Wife, married, age 49, born Edenbridge, Kent
    Alfred E Smith, M, Son, age 14, born Edenbridge, Kent
    Arthur Smith, M, Son, age 3, born Edenbridge, Kent

21Mill CottageWilliam Rumsby, M, Head, married, age 45, born Oxted, Surrey; occupation Shoemaker
    Emily Rumsby, F, Wife, married, age 44, born Southborough, Kent
    Albert Rumsby, M, Son, age 12,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ation Scholar
    Minnie Rumsby, F, Daughter, age 9,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ation Scholar
    Alice Rumsby, F, Daughter, age 6,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ation Scholar
    Edith Rumsby, F, Granddaughter, age 4, born Edenbridge, Kent
    Albert Huggett, M, Lodger, single, age 19, born Rotherfield, Sussex; occupation: tanner

21Mill CottageRobert Child, M, Head, married, age 53, born Penshurst, Kent; occupation: fishmonger
    Alice Child, F, Wife, married, age 38, born Cowden, Kent

21High StreetRobert Dome Smith, M, Head, single, age 25, born Penshurst, Kent; occupation: grocer and draper
    Adelaide Groves, F, Mother, widowed, age 60, born Aylesford, Kent
    Peter Mcintyre Smith, M, Brother, single, age 20, born Edenbridge, Kent; occupation: butcher's assistant
